Este curso de Python ajudará o leitor a entender todos os elementos vitais da linguagem de programação Python. Qualquer pessoa que deseja aprender a linguagem de programação Python sem experiência prévia em programação e qualquer pessoa que deseja refrescar seu conhecimento em Python pode ler este artigo e se familiarizar com conceitos amplamente utilizados em Python.

Curso de Python – índice:

  1. Começando com o curso de Python
  2. Instalando o Python
  3. Introdução ao Python
  4. Vantagens e desvantagens de usar Python
  5. Configurando um Ambiente de Desenvolvimento Integrado:
  6. Escrevendo o primeiro código usando o IDE VS Code:

Começando com o curso de Python

Após ler este curso de Python, o leitor será capaz de escrever programas em Python, usar quaisquer bibliotecas Python e desenvolver seus próprios pacotes usando Python.

O primeiro passo para aprender qualquer linguagem de programação é configurar o ambiente para escrever programas. Como estamos passando por um curso de Python, começaremos instalando o Python em três plataformas de sistema operacional diferentes.

Instalação do Python:

Para verificar se o Python já está instalado, siga os passos mencionados abaixo.

  • Pressione Windows ⊞ + r para abrir o executar.
  • Em seguida, digite cmd e pressione enter.
python_course

Após abrir o cmd, você pode verificar se o Python já está instalado digitando python no cmd.

python_course

Também podemos verificar a versão do Python instalada usando os comandos conforme demonstrado abaixo.

python_course

Instalando o Python

Agora vamos passar por como instalar o Python no Windows e links são fornecidos para navegação rápida ao seguir o artigo. A partir do link do Python para Windows, a versão estável do Python pode ser baixada com sua escolha entre versões de sistema operacional de 64 bits ou 32 bits.

Link para o Python: https://www.python.org/downloads/windows/

python_course

Como podemos ver, o último lançamento disponível para o Python 3 é o Python 3.10.0. Agora clique no Último Lançamento do Python 3 – Python 3.10.0 e isso o levará à página de download onde, se rolarmos para baixo até o final da página, encontraremos uma tabela como abaixo.

python_course

Agora clique no Instalador do Windows (32 bits) ou Instalador do Windows (64 bits) de acordo com sua preferência. Uma janela será aberta pedindo que você selecione o caminho onde deseja baixar seu instalador. Após baixar o arquivo executável, clique duas vezes no arquivo para iniciar a instalação.

Passos:

  • Execute o arquivo executável do Python, no nosso caso será Python-3.10.0.exe.
  • Quando você clicar duas vezes no arquivo, uma janela será aberta perguntando se você deseja executar este arquivo. Clique em executar para iniciar a instalação do Python.
  • De acordo com sua escolha, selecione se deseja que o Python seja instalado para todos os usuários ou para um único usuário.
  • Além disso, selecione a caixa de seleção adicionar python 3.10 ao PATH.
python_course
  • Em seguida, selecione instalar agora. Instalar agora instalará o Python com todas as configurações recomendadas, o que é uma boa opção para iniciantes.
  • Então levará alguns minutos para a configuração ser concluída, e você será levado ao próximo prompt de diálogo que pedirá para desativar o limite de comprimento do caminho. Isso permitirá que o Python use nomes de caminho longos sem qualquer limite de caracteres de 260, que é habilitado se o limite de comprimento do caminho não for desativado.
  • Para verificar se o Python está instalado, você pode usar o Python -V ou Python –version ou apenas digitar Python no cmd.
python_course Parabéns, você instalou o Python com sucesso. Vamos escrever nosso primeiro programa no cmd usando Python.
  • No nosso primeiro programa, apenas imprimiremos “Parabéns!!, você instalou o Python corretamente”.
  • Para escrever isso, usaremos a função print do Python.
  • Digite print(“Parabéns!!, você instalou o Python corretamente”).
  • Em seguida, pressione enter.
  • Você verá que a declaração que escrevemos dentro do print é exibida como abaixo.
python_course

Introdução ao Python

Python é uma linguagem de programação interpretada, de alto nível, dinamicamente tipada e orientada a objetos.

Antes de nos aprofundarmos na escrita de programas em Python, é importante entender o que os termos acima significam.

Linguagem de Alto Nível

Uma linguagem de alto nível dá ao programador liberdade para codificar programas que são independentes de um tipo específico de dispositivo. Elas são chamadas de linguagens de alto nível porque estão mais próximas das linguagens humanas. Python é de alto nível porque não é uma linguagem compilada, o Python requer outro programa para executar o código, ao contrário do C, que é executado diretamente no processador local.

Linguagem Interpretada

Python é uma linguagem interpretada, pois o código-fonte do programa Python é convertido em bytecode que é então executado na máquina virtual Python, ao contrário do C ou C++.

Linguagem Dinamicamente Tipada

Python é uma linguagem dinamicamente tipada porque o tipo da variável é verificado durante o tempo de execução. Aprenderemos sobre tipos de dados nos blogs seguintes.

Linguagem Orientada a Objetos

Python é uma linguagem orientada a objetos, porque o desenvolvedor Python pode usar classes e objetos para escrever código limpo e reutilizável.

python_course

Vantagens e desvantagens de usar Python

Vantagens de usar Python

  • Como as sintaxes do Python estão mais próximas da linguagem humana, é mais fácil aprender, entender e escrever o código.
  • É uma linguagem funcional e orientada a objetos.
  • Python tem um grande suporte da comunidade e também possui um grande número de módulos, bibliotecas e pacotes.
  • Devido à sua simplicidade, desenvolver um programa ou aplicativo em Python é mais rápido do que desenvolver em qualquer outra linguagem, como Java.
  • Python é uma escolha de linguagem em ciência de dados, aprendizado de máquina e inteligência artificial devido à sua ampla variedade de pacotes e bibliotecas de aprendizado de máquina.
  • Quase tudo pode ser desenvolvido usando Python, ele também possui ferramentas para desenvolvimento de aplicativos, como kivy, flask, Django e muitos outros.

Desvantagens de usar Python

  • Não é recomendado para comunicação com componentes de hardware.
  • Não há otimizadores de tempo no Python, portanto, é mais lento do que a maioria das linguagens, como C, C++ e Java.
  • A codificação baseada em indentação torna um pouco difícil para pessoas que mudam sua linguagem de C, C++ ou Java para Python.

Configurando um Ambiente de Desenvolvimento Integrado:

Usaremos o Visual Studio Code para escrever código em Python. O Visual Studio Code, abreviado como VS Code, é um editor de código de código aberto com muitos plugins e extensões. Esses plugins e extensões tornam a escrita de código no VS Code mais simples e intuitiva. Além disso, o VS Code é muito leve em comparação com outros IDEs. Ele também possui vários temas para tornar o ambiente de desenvolvimento interessante para o desenvolvedor.

Instalando o VS Code no Windows:

  • Usando o link abaixo, baixe o arquivo executável do VS Code. Link: https://code.visualstudio.com/docs/setup/windows
  • Em seguida, clique duas vezes no arquivo baixado para executá-lo e clique em executar. Depois siga os passos conforme mostrado nas imagens abaixo.
  • Clique em Eu aceito o acordo e clique em próximo.
  • python_course
  • Selecione as caixas de seleção conforme mostrado na imagem abaixo e clique em próximo.
  • python_course
  • Em seguida, clique em instalar e levará alguns minutos para a configuração do VS Code ser concluída. Após a conclusão da configuração, clique no botão finalizar.
python_course

Escrevendo o primeiro código usando o IDE VS Code:

  • Abra o VS Code e você verá uma janela como mostrada abaixo.
  • python_course
  • Clique em arquivo para abrir o menu de arquivo e clique em novo arquivo como mostrado abaixo.
  • python_course
  • Em seguida, uma aba será aberta no VS Code chamada Sem Título-1 como mostrado abaixo.
  • python_course
  • Clique em selecionar uma linguagem e a janela abaixo será aberta onde você deve selecionar Python.
  • python_course
  • Em seguida, digite o código print(“Python Instalado com Sucesso!!!”) como mostrado abaixo.
  • python_course
  • Em seguida, vá para a aba de execução como mostrado abaixo e selecione executar sem depuração.
  • python_course
  • Então o VS Code pedirá que você salve o arquivo. Salve o arquivo no diretório que desejar. Ele executará o arquivo após salvar e mostrará o resultado como abaixo.
python_course

Você também pode gostar do nosso Curso de JavaScript do Iniciante ao Avançado.

Robert Whitney

Especialista em JavaScript e instrutor que orienta departamentos de TI. Seu principal objetivo é aumentar a produtividade da equipe, ensinando os outros a cooperar efetivamente enquanto codificam.

View all posts →